microsoft sce

Server and Cloud Enrollment (SCE) is a licensing vehicle under the Enterprise Agreement that enables organizations to standardize on one or more Microsoft server and cloud technologies. To enroll in SCE, you will make an installed base commitment to one or more components.

How does Azure monetary commitment?

Microsoft Azure Monetary Commitment is the upfront payment a Microsoft Enterprise Agreement (EA) customer makes for use of the Microsoft Azure consumption services, which is then decremented on a monthly basis as the services are used.

What is Microsoft MACC?

The Microsoft Azure Consumption Commitment (MACC) is a contractual commitment that your organization may have made to Microsoft Azure spend over time.

What is Microsoft MCA?

Enable your customers to start using products and services faster by adopting the Microsoft Customer Agreement (MCA), a simplified, non-expiring contract, which effectively replaces the current Microsoft Cloud Agreement.

What is Azure plan?

Microsoft has introduced a new commerce experience in Partner Center, the Azure plan. With this new commerce experience, partners will gain access to Azure services at pay-as-you-go rates for customers under the Microsoft Customer Agreement.

What is the difference between perpetual and subscription licenses?

The core difference between subscription vs. perpetual license is that subscription software is priced on a yearly or monthly basis and is an ongoing subscription. A perpetual plan license, on the other hand, is paid up-front in one, big lump sum.
